What’s behind the spooky investing environment?

by Interactive Brokers Traders Insight|Published October 30, 2020

Steve Sosnick, Interactive Brokers’ chief strategist, discusses why the market seems to be afraid of everything.

With markets trying to balance greed and fear, there have been some valuations stretched more than they possibly should.

What’s behind the market volatility and how long will it last?
